Rosalie Maggio Quotes
Absolute Freedom Doesn't Exist And Never Did. Just As We Don't Spit On The Floor At Work, Swear At Customers, Or Send Out Letters Full Of Misspellings, So Too We Might Have To 'watch Our Language.' It Is Odd That The Request For Unbiased Language In Schools And Workplaces Is Considered Intolerable When Other Limits On Our Freedom To Do Whatever We Want Are Not.
